Making the Right Choice: What Works Best for You?
| Option | Features | Pros | Cons | Price Guide |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Basic Wedding Horse Hire | White horse with handler, standard decorations | Affordable, reliable, classic look | Limited extras, less personalised | £350 - £500 |
| Decorated Ghodi Hire | Traditional red/gold embroidery, feather plumes, experienced handler | Authentic Indian wedding style, great for Baraat | Requires early booking, slightly higher cost | £600 - £850 |
| Luxury Horse Entrance Package | White horse, handler, Band Baja or drummers, luxury carriage option | Fully styled, grand entrance, flexible for fusion weddings | Premium price, logistics planning needed | £1000+ |
Questions About Wedding Horse Hire?
How early should I book my wedding horse?
We recommend booking as soon as your date is confirmed, especially if you want a decorated Ghodi or a luxury package. Popular dates in Denbighshire, like weekends in the LL16 postcode, tend to book up fast.
Are the horses safe around crowds and music?
Absolutely. All our horses are trained to stay calm amid the noise and excitement of weddings. Our professional handlers are with them every step of the way to ensure safety and comfort.
Can the horses be used indoors?
Yes, but it depends on the venue’s suitability and permissions. Many venues in and around Denbigh, including some near the town centre, welcome White Wedding Horses indoors with prior arrangement.
What extra services can I add?
We offer extras like drummers (Dhol), Band Baja, and luxury carriages to enhance your entrance. These can be tailored to traditional or fusion wedding styles.
